In this episode of The CTO Podcast, hosts Lucas and Luna dive into Stripe's architectural journey from a simple payment API to a global infrastructure handling payments in over 100 countries and 135 currencies. They explore how Stripe tackled regulatory complexity, latency, and reliability at scale — from its early days of processing a few thousand transactions to now handling billions of dollars annually. The conversation covers Stripe's core system design, including its use of idempotency keys, event-driven architecture, and a multi-region deployment strategy. Lucas shares insights from Stripe's engineering blog and talks about the trade-offs they made: choosing consistency over availability in payment processing, and building a custom database layer to handle financial transactions. Luna questions how Stripe manages compliance across jurisdictions, and Lucas explains their approach to modular compliance and local data residency.
